Bon Iver is an American indie folk band formed in 2006 by Justin Vernon in Eau Claire, Wisconsin. Originally a solo project, the group expanded to include members Sean Carey, Michael Lewis, Matthew McCaughan, Andrew Fitzpatrick, and Jenn Wasner. Their debut album, For Emma, Forever Ago, was recorded by Vernon in isolation in a Wisconsin cabin and gained widespread recognition upon its 2007 release. Bon Iver’s self-titled second album won the Grammy Award for Best Alternative Music Album in 2012. Known for their experimental and evolving sound, the band received critical acclaim for 22, A Million in 2016 and a Grammy nomination for Album of the Year for I, I in 2019. Their latest album, Sable, Fable, arrived in 2025. The name Bon Iver is inspired by the French phrase for good winter.
